Mashal Yousafzai awarded PTI’s Senate ticket for by-election on reserved seat

PESHAWAR: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) has issued a Senate ticket to Mashal Yousafzai for the by-election on a reserved seat, following the resignation of Sania Nishtar.

The decision to award the ticket to Yousafzai came on the instructions of PTI founder Imran Khan.

PTI Chairman Barrister Gohar officially announced the move through a notification, which also instructed other party candidates—Sajida Begum, Mumena Basit, Samira Shams, and Saima Khalid—to withdraw their candidacies by July 30.

The by-election for the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a women’s Senate seat is set for July 31, with the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P) confirming the polling schedule. This Senate seat became vacant following the resignation of Sania Nishtar, a member of PTI.
